Current digital gambling sites rely on advanced engineering frameworks that operate perpetually to offer gaming experiences. Each spin, card deal, or dice roll involves several technical components operating at once. Participants communicate with display displays, but multiple tasks execute in milliseconds to guarantee precise outputs.

Gaming platforms combine multiple software elements that exchange through uniform protocols. These infrastructures handle player accounts, handle monetary processes, and transmit game content from external servers. The structure must manage thousands of simultaneous participants while preserving performance benchmarks.

Behind every gaming instance, repositories log all transaction and consequence for audit objectives. Encryption systems protect confidential information during transmission. Tracking systems follow operational statistics and spot deviations that might indicate system issues. Transaction handling infrastructures follow to strict security criteria that dictate how card information is treated and stored. Tokenization replaces original card sequences with unpredictably issued placeholders, lowering danger if databases are accessed. Most sites send operations through dedicated payment processors rather than retaining whole financial information.

When a user launches a session, the casino site transmits a command to the provider’s server. Verification tokens confirm the session authenticity and establish a encrypted channel. The game then appears within an integrated container on the casino interface, generating a seamless visual presentation.

Data synchronization ensures that player funds, stake sums, and prizes sync exactly across both infrastructures.

Connection techniques fluctuate depending on technological specifications. Some suppliers deliver direct API connections, while others use consolidation hubs that merge numerous game catalogs. Encoding systems safeguard critical data as it transmits between player devices and casino platforms. Data level security protocols form encrypted links that prevent eavesdropping of monetary content, authentication information, and personal data. These standards employ intricate cryptographic formulas to encrypt data into indecipherable types.
